The original Gran Turismo (1997) was a revolutionary title that transformed the racing genre. Prior to its release, racing games typically focused on arcade-style Malaysia online casino gameplay, but Gran Turismo introduced a hyper-realistic driving simulation that set new standards for the genre. With over 140 cars, realistic physics, and a career mode that encouraged players to truly learn the art of driving, Gran Turismo offered an unparalleled level of depth. It wasn’t just about racing; it was about experiencing the thrill of motorsports, learning the intricacies of car mechanics, and meticulously tuning vehicles. The success of Gran Turismo helped solidify the PlayStation as the go-to console for sports and simulation games, and it paved the way for future racing games with similarly sophisticated designs.
Another key milestone in the PlayStation’s history came with the release of Final Fantasy VII (1997), which was not only a defining moment for the RPG genre but also Live casino malaysia for the PlayStation itself. Final Fantasy VII was one of the first games to push the limits of what was possible in terms of storytelling, with its expansive world, complex characters, and epic narrative. Its use of full-motion video (FMV) and 3D rendered environments showcased the PlayStation’s technological capabilities, while its deep, turn-based combat system and open-ended world design helped elevate the JRPG genre. The emotional weight of Cloud Strife’s journey, along with the unforgettable character of Aerith, made Final Fantasy VII an enduring classic that continues to influence the gaming world today. The game’s success proved that video games could offer experiences on par with film, shifting public perception of gaming as a form of entertainment.

The original PlayStation console, released in 1994, marked a major shift in gaming history. It was the first console to use CD-ROMs instead of cartridges, offering developers more storage space for larger and more detailed games. The PlayStation’s graphics capabilities were also a leap forward from its competitors, introducing 3D graphics in games like Crash Bandicoot and Tekken 3. These innovations allowed for more expansive worlds and more complex characters, marking the beginning of a new era in gaming. Titles like Final Fantasy VII and Metal Gear Solid not only showcased the power of the PlayStation hardware but also pushed the boundaries of storytelling in games, introducing players to more mature and cinematic narratives.
The release of the PlayStation 2 in 2000 marked another significant leap in the evolution of PlayStation games. Not only was the PS2 the most powerful console of its generation, but it also introduced the DVD format, allowing developers to create even more expansive games with larger audio and video files. The PS2’s hardware allowed for more realistic character models, expansive open-world environments, and detailed cinematics. Grand Theft Auto: San Andreas, Shadow of the Colossus, and Final Fantasy X all pushed the boundaries of what was possible on the PS2, with San Andreas offering a massive open world, Shadow of the Colossus showcasing breathtaking visuals and minimalist gameplay, and Final Fantasy X delivering a fully realized fantasy world and a compelling story. The PS2 also marked the beginning of a shift toward narrative-driven games that offered more cinematic experiences.
With the PlayStation 3, released in 2006, came the era of high-definition gaming. The PS3 introduced the Blu-ray disc format, enabling even larger games and better-quality video. Its processing power allowed for a higher level of realism in both graphics and gameplay, leading to a significant leap in the quality of games. This was evident in titles like The Last of Us, Uncharted 2, and God of War III. These games showcased not only stunning visuals but also the evolution of complex characters and stories. The Last of Us in particular was a game that pushed the boundaries of narrative and character development, with a plot that was both heartbreaking and compelling. The PS3 also introduced the PlayStation Network (PSN), enabling online multiplayer, digital downloads, and game updates, further enhancing the overall gaming experience.

Grand Theft Auto: Liberty City Stories is yet another standout title in the PSP’s library. A spin-off of Grand Theft Auto III, this game lets players once again explore the bustling streets of Liberty City, engaging in a variety of criminal activities while completing a host of missions. The open-world design and freedom of choice that Grand Theft Auto is known for translated perfectly to the PSP, giving players the ability to roam the city, engage in shootouts, and even participate in side activities like taxi driving or paramedic missions. Liberty City Stories proved that the PSP could handle the depth and complexity of open-world games, offering a portable version of one of the most beloved franchises in gaming.
